Nnnunpolarized light pdf programming languages

The axis of the first filter is horizontal and the axis of the second filter makes an angle of 36. I suppose you are a beginner to programming so i would suggest dont go for any ide just now. The languages used to give such instructions to a computer are referred as the programming language. It has around 10 million registered users and hosts over 16 million public. If activated in the target settings the sampling trace allows you to trace and display the actual course of variables over an extended period of time. The intensity of the light after it has passed through the second filter is. There are different generations of programming languages are available. Getting started with the internet of things features clear explanations and stepbystep examples that use inexpensive, easytofind components. The clips users guide is designed for people who want a quick introduction to expert system programming in a handson manner. Every latest version of netbeans comes with an improved and efficient java editor. This is an excellent introduction to both the operational and denotational semantics of programming languages.

As far as this course is concerned, the relevant chapters are 24, 9 sections 1,2, and 5, 11 sections 1,2,5, and 6 and 14. Programming langauge choices for sdn code, clouds, and. I can only assume that it has been upgraded to gui. The book is ideal for hobbyists and inventors who want to get started with the spark core by connecting to the cloud. There are many embeddable implementation of ecmascript like. This paper forms the substance of a course of lectures given at the international summer school in computer programming at copenhagen in august, 1967. The best programming languages for some specific contexts. Python is an interpreted, highlevel, generalpurpose programming language. A lightweight programming language is one that is designed to have very small memory footprint, is easy to implement andor has minimalist syntax and features.

How to detect polarized light from unpolarized light quora. Computer programming is fun and easy to learn provided you adopt a proper approach. Halide, a new and improved programming language for image. Computer programming is the act of writing computer programs, which are a sequence of instructions written using a computer programming language to perform a specified task by the computer. Each of their emissions can be approximately modeled as a short wave train lasting from about 10. Also, since learning a new language can be a frustrating experience, the writing is in a light, humorous style. Io is a prototypebased objectoriented scripting language. Some of them like lisp, forth, tcl are so simple to implement.

Other than the velleman kit itself, most of the materials you need to build a color organ circuit can be purchased at your local radioshack store or any other supplier of electronic components. The third generation programming languages are also known as highlevel languages. Early programming languages were highly specialized, relying on mathematical notation and similarly obscure syntax. Unpolarized light on polarizers polaroid sheets only i02 is transmi tted of unpolariz ed light by a polariz er and it is polariz ed along the transmission axis. In the recent past, many low level electronics required programming in assembly. Language, a system of conventional spoken, manual, or written symbols by means of which human beings, as members of a social group and participants in its culture, express themselves. Nonpolarized light has no polarization, even at a certain point in the space and at a certain time. The reason is if you are new to programming then you might want to learn new things, code faster, memorize syntax and get expert in coding. Unpolarized light passes through three polarizing filters.

Apr 06, 2009 unpolarized light is incident on a system of three polarizers. Light pattern a language which uses a series of photographs rather than. Interest in degree and nondegree training in cobol and enterprise computing languages was on the rise even before the covid19 crisis photo. This book is an introduction to the study of human language across the planet. Perhaps the most impressive aspect of this book is that it teaches how to evaluate a programming language. Syntax, semantics, types, abstraction on data, delayed evaluation on data and on control, type correctness, evaluators for functional programming, logic programming, imperative programming.

Python is the language of choice for one of the most popular microcontrollers on the market, the raspberry pi, said covey. What you need to build a color organ circuit dummies. What are the most popular plc programming languages. Comparative studies of 10 programming languages within 10 diverse criteria a team 10 comp6411s10 term report 4 1. Which programming language is the fastest and most lightweight. We want to know the best programming language for us, for the situation we. Nonenglishbased programming languages are programming languages that do not use. Programming language used getting started particle.

When they need a smart device in the lab, theyre happy to use a language they know, python. Both local and global appearances of text block are useful cues for distinguishing between text and nontext regions fig. The history of programming languages spans from documentation of early mechanical computers to modern tools for software development. If on rotation of nicol prism, intensity of emitted light can be completely extinguished at two places in each rotation, then light is plane polarised. Quantity description 1 velleman mk110 simple onee channel light organ kit 1 2x3x6inch project. They have a javascript interpreter for it documented here. Pdf investigating faultproneness through hotfix commits. So, there are many lightweight implementations of it. The scattering of unpolarized light by very small objects, with sizes much less than the wavelength of the light called rayleigh scattering, after the english scientist lord rayleigh, also produces a partial polarization. For each language he describes different unique features of the language. The 5 most popular plc programming languages are ladder diagram ld, sequential function charts sfc, function block diagram fbd, structured text st, and instruction list il. Programming language icons free download, png and svg. Multioriented text detection with fully convolutional networks. You cant represent incoherent light with jones vectors 2 components, but you can do it with density matrices this approach has a huge importance in quantum mechanics, where incoherent mixtures are most important.

Dialects of basic, esoteric programming languages, and markup languages are not included. In the 1940s, jean jennings bartik, betty holberton, marlyn wescoff, kathleen mcnulty, ruth teitelbaum, and frances spence developed subroutines. Which way are the polymers in your sunglasses oriented. Objectoriented programming languages and eventdriven programming. Java multimedia on the web has expanded rapidly as broadband connections have allowed users to connect at faster speeds. Rust is a multiparadigm system programming language focused on safety especially safe. A lightweight programming language is one that is designed to have very small memory footprint, is easy to implement important when porting a language to different systems, andor has minimalist syntax and features. May 09, 2012 it is based on the programming language pl1 that ibm used way back when and is one of the first programming languages. A log records operations, user actions and internal processes during an online session in a chronological order. Class26 polarized light 2 7 polarizer example unpolarized light with an intensity of i0 16 wm2 is incident on a pair of polarizers.

Youre more of a teacherfacilitator than purely a programmer except for the heavy lifting. This experiment employed an individual differences approach to test the hypothesis that learning modern programming languages resembles second natural language learning in adulthood. These are the best programming languages to learn to land a great developer job and to earn more money. If the beams are from different sources, then youre pretty much there, as they wont stay in phase. Codesys puts a simple approach to the powerful iec language at the disposal of the plc programmer. This person will begin by configuring the consoles initial settings. Attendees of this two day course will acquire the skills and supporting knowledge to perform start up and maintain an nlight control system. What is the ratio of the intensity of light emerging from the. Unpolarized light with intensity i 0 is passed two polarizing filters.

Generations of programming languages first, second. Although it would be impossible to teach one programming language and technique that would be applicable to each and every programmable controller on the market, the student can be given a thorough insight into programming methods with this general approach which will allow him or her. It was like going through the tough and was tiered and given a break of my searching. Jul 06, 2008 ok, if you are new to programming this might take you a bit longer that 30 minutes but with a bit of practice you could do it in 20. We cover the c language from the ground up from a nonhardware specific point of view in order to focus on the various elements of the c language itself. The light then goes though polarizer 2 with its plane of polarization at 45. The functions of language include communication, the expression of identity, play, imaginative expression, and emotional release. However, the use of these methods to write programs requires some skill in programming and plcs are intended to be used by engineers without any great knowledge of programming. In light of todays cambrian explosion of new programming languages, this course also seeks to provide a conceptual clarity on how to compare and contrast the multitude of programming languages, models, and paradigms in the modern programming landscape. In programming, lower level language means that it gets closer to machine language the 1s and 0s and the commands closely resemble that of the microprocessors programs. The book is the textbook for the programming languages course at brown. Fundamental concepts in programming languages christopher strachey reader in computation at oxford university, programming research group, 45 banbury road, oxford, uk abstract.

That document really is the original ansi c89 standard, just in a rereprinted form. Fundamentals of the c programming language this class provides an introduction to the c programming language as specified by the ansi c89 standard in the context of embedded systems. Mar 17, 2018 using a polaroid plane polarised light. Illustration about computer algorithm computer science problem solving process with programming language code concept light bulb and gear vector. Abstract specifies the form and establishes the interpretation of programs written in the c programming language. However if you want to stick with js, then you may want to look at a particle variant made by redbear called the duo. When the programmer begins his or her work, the lighting is already in place according to the designers plot. Created by guido van rossum and first released in 1991, pythons design philosophy emphasizes code readability with its notable use of significant whitespace. Forth is a stackbased concatenative imperative programming language using reverse polish notation. Avoiding the pitfalls of other languages being objectoriented enabling users to create streamlined and clear code.

These are the best programming languages to learn to land a great. The second polarizer has its transmission axis aligned at 20 from the vertical. Thus, when the light with intensity i 1 comes to the second polarizer, the angle between the light s polarization plane and the axis of the second polarizer is just the angle between the axes of the two polarizers, as listed in the problem. Fundamentals of the c programming language developer help. To learn more about how to develop functions in the supported languages, see the following resources. Ott is a tool for writing definitions of programming languages and calculi. Netbeans is open source and best ide for java developers and programmers. The serverside runtime environment for javascript has opened up a range of uses for the browserbased language. The author has chosen 7 languages as the title suggests.

Download icons in all formats or edit them for your designs. Python basics, booleans, strings, modules, loops, lists, dictionaries, files, classes, sorting. If there is limited programming expertise in a company, there may be a need to let some of the power users to take over app development. While it would be nice to know every programming language under the sun, the fact of the matter is you may not have the time or inclination to achieve that. It facilitates the development of applications that demand safety, security, or business integrity. The language is often the first choice for social scientists and biologists, for instance. The electromagnetic wave emanating from the filament is a superposition of these wave trains, each having its own polarization. A complete collection of the smallest possible programs, in each existing programming language. The aim of this list of programming languages is to include all notable programming languages in existence, both those in current use and historical ones, in alphabetical order. Lowcomplexity visible light networking with ledtoled. Using content negotiation, the server then selects one of the proposals, uses it and informs the client of its choice with the content language response header. Getting started with the internet of things shows you, step by step, how to program and control electronics projects from the cloud and have fun discovering the power of the internet of things iot.

Unpolarized light with intensity i0 is passed two pol. Comparative studies of 10 programming languages within 10 diverse criteria revision 1. In the third generations of programming languages, english language with symbols and digits were used to write the programs. Concert lighting programming in 30 minutes stage lighting. Another problem that twitter had was that lamp model of ruby. Lowcomplexity visible light networking with ledtoled communication abstract. It is concerned with the immense variety among the languages of the world, as well as the common traits that cut across the differences. These programming languages have simple syntax and semantics, so they could be learnt easily and in little time. Objectoriented programming languages and eventdriven programming yeager, dorian p. The standard when it comes to sockets and hard core network programming. This standard is identical with and has been reproduced from isoiec 9899. The first is oriented with a horizontal transmission axis, the second has its transmission axis radians from the horizontal, and the third has a vertical transmission axis. The study of programming languages is equal parts systems and theory, looking at how a rigorous understanding of the syntax, structure.

A lightweight programming language is one that is designed to have very small memory footprint, is easy to implement important when porting a language to different systems, andor has minimalist syntax and features these programming languages have simple syntax and semantics, so they could be learnt easily and in little time. When sunlight passes through earths atmosphere, it is scattered by air molecules. The first polarizer has its transmission axis aligned at 50 from the vertical. In all its quantum forms spoken, toned, sung, written, signed with the hands, quietly beamed from the heart or emitted as invisible flashes of light in geometric patterns, codes and colors the language of light always carries a divine blessing that is perfect for each one receiving it in that moment. Computer algorithm science problem solving process with. Its language constructs and objectoriented approach aim to help programmers write clear, logical code for small and largescale projects. Also, how do gc languages compare to non gc languages when considering resources other than memory, eg. When i was surfing for the course, there are may things were scrolling in my mind. Halide is a computer programming language designed for writing digital image processing code that takes advantage of memory locality, vectorized computation and multicore cpus and gpus. Discover how to connect to wifi networks, attach hardware to io ports, write custom programs, and work from the cloud.

Unpolarized light on polarizers uwmadison department of. By languages, we mean natural languages, such as english, and not programming languages. Whether youre creating the next, great, iot project, or just want an easy to use, overtheairprogrammable arm cortext m3 development board, the photon is an excellent foundation. The elements of programming, theoretical introduction of programming languages. Oct 14, 2014 polarization of a light wave is defined as a type of orientation of oscillations of the wave with respect to the direction of propagation of the wave. Topics covered include sensorview navigation and operation, detailed programming for sequence of operation, start up best practices, and troubleshooting. Our survey work involves a comparative study of these ten.

Get free icons of programming language in ios, material, windows and other design styles for web, mobile, and graphic design projects. Oo languages mostly allow you to implement gc see comment about smart pointers. Particles photon development board is an awesomely powerful platform for projects that require wifi and internetconnectivity. Cs 242 explores models of computation, both old, like functional programming with the lambda calculus circa 1930, and new, like memorysafe systems programming with rust circa 2010. Like many programming languages, nandlang borrows a lot of its syntax from c. The atoms on the surface of a heated filament, which generate light, act independently of one another. In total, there are 4 generations of programming languages are available.

This list is universal, comprised of programming languages and document formats. It is developed by a team of jetbrains and first appeared in 2011. Free programming languages books online download ebooks. The free images are pixel perfect to fit your design and available in both png and vector. The best programming languages to learn in 2020 techrepublic. Apr 26, 2010 in the figure below, unpolarized light with an intensity of 18 wm2 is sent into a system of four polarizing sheets with polarizing directions at angles.

Other than a wellthought design, it has some specific features for concurrency like a type of light weight processes called goroutines. Basic plc programming how to program a plc using ladder. Higher level language is closer to the user because it is easier to understand due to. This section will go over the basic syntax of nandlang. Which is the best compileride for basic programming. Comparative studies of 10 programming languages within 10. List of hello world programs in 200 programming languages. Learn vocabulary, terms, and more with flashcards, games, and other study tools. Lighting programming is about a clear set of goals and an efficient use of your programming time something that is harder if you dont have a theatre style plotting sheet.

Which of the following languages is an objectoriented programming language developed by sun microsystems that is often used when data needs to be shared across a network. Yes they are not easy but they help a lot, and they are deterministic. Visible light communication vlc is an emerging technology in which light emitting diodes leds transport information wirelessly, using the visible light spectrum. This tutorial attempts to cover the basics of computer programming. In an effort to improve imageprocessing software, a team of researchers developed a new programming language called halide, which is easier to read, write and revise and is significantly faster because halide automates codeoptimization procedures. Spark is a formally defined computer programming language based on the ada programming language, intended for the development of high integrity software used in systems where predictable and highly reliable operation is essential. I mean, you can measure the projection of the polarization on some direction and if at the certain point and time, all the photons pass through the polarizer, then at the given point and time the beam is polarized. Programming, programming languages and programming methods. When an electromagnetic wave is incident on the film, electric field components that are parallel to the molecules cause electrons to oscillate back and forth along the molecules. As a consequence, ladder programming was developed. The second polarizer is oriented at an angle of 33. By comparison, text blocks possess more distinguishable and stable properties. It is used to build desktop, web and mobile applications using java programming language. Objectoriented programming languages and eventdriven.

I know that after iincident passes through the first. Robot software and best programming language for robotics. Supported languages in azure functions microsoft docs. So, in some way, it is a language designed to persuade c people to enter the new century. This thesis investigates securitytyped programming languages, which use static typ ing to enforce informationflow security policies.

1220 136 872 1175 697 193 872 668 564 139 1133 1648 143 1425 1532 1654 1324 1061 1029 406 1494 37 1486 186 1429 1402 265 948 324 1198 121 997 81